In November, Bull Run, United States, experiences a dynamic range of weather characterized by a maximum temperature of 25°C (77°F), an average of 8°C (47°F), and minimums dipping to -5°C (23°F). This month is marked by moderate precipitation, totaling 85 mm (3.3 in) over approximately 7 days, which contributes to the area's lush landscape. With humidity levels averaging 86%, residents and visitors can expect a crisp, yet damp atmosphere, making it a time of transition into winter's embrace. November and January weather present distinct contrasts in temperature and precipitation. November typically experiences milder conditions with average temperatures around 8°C (47°F) and a maximum reaching 25°C (77°F). In contrast, January tends to be colder, with an average temperature of only 3°C (37°F) and a minimum dropping to -15°C (5°F). While November has higher precipitation levels at 85 mm (3.3 in) over 7 days, January is slightly drier with 60 mm (2.4 in) across the same number of days. Despite these differences, both months share a high humidity of 86%, contributing to a damp atmosphere.
